Pre-Production: The Foundation of Successful Event Video Coverage
Great event videos start long before the cameras roll. Proper planning ensures your production team is aligned with your goals and prepared for any logistical challenges.
1. Define Your Objectives
Ask yourself:
What type of video content do you need? (highlight reel, full presentations, interviews, live streaming)
Who is the target audience?
Where will the videos be published?
Clear goals will guide camera placement, needed equipment, and crew size.
2. Conduct a Venue Walkthrough
Professional event venues and video production companies like TriVision always perform a site visit to:
Assess lighting conditions
Identify ideal camera angles
Check sound quality
Determine power sources and cable routing
This eliminates surprises on event day.

3. Create a Shooting Schedule
Collaborate with your production team to plan:
Key moments (speeches, awards, performances)
Interview windows
B-roll opportunities
Setup and teardown times
A detailed schedule keeps everyone on track.
4. Coordinate with Event Staff
Your video team should be in sync with:
Stage managers
Lighting technicians
AV teams
Event coordinators
This ensures smooth transitions and proper timing for big moments.
During the Event: Best Practices for Capturing High-Quality Footage
The day of the event is where preparation meets execution. Here’s how to ensure your footage stands out.
1. Use Multiple Cameras
Multi-camera setups create dynamic, professional-looking videos.
A typical setup might include:
A wide-angle camera covering the full stage
A close-up camera focused on speakers
A roaming handheld or gimbal camera for audience reactions and B-roll
This allows editors to seamlessly switch angles and maintain visual interest.
2. Capture Clean, Crisp Audio
Audio can make or break your event video. To get it right:
Use direct feeds from the venue’s soundboard
Place lavalier mics on speakers
Use shotgun mics for ambient sound

3. Prioritize Good Lighting
Conference rooms and ballrooms aren’t always optimized for video.
Professionals will:
Adjust exposure manually
Add supplemental lighting if needed
Work with the venue’s lighting crew to illuminate the stage properly
Good lighting ensures your footage looks clean, sharp, and vibrant.
4. Capture Engaging B-Roll
B-roll is essential for storytelling. Examples include:
Audience reactions
Networking moments
Sponsor booths
Decor and branding
Behind-the-scenes setup
This footage helps create energetic highlight reels and promotional videos.
5. Conduct On-Site Interviews
Live interviews add authenticity and personality.
Ideal candidates include:
Speakers
Award recipients
Sponsors
Attendees
A quick 1–2 minute interview can provide powerful testimonials.
Live Streaming: Reaching Audiences in Real Time
Livestreaming has become a standard for corporate events, and high-quality streaming requires expertise.
Tips for Better Livestreams
Use hard-wired internet whenever possible
Stream with multiple cameras
Add branded graphics and lower thirds
Test all connections before going live
Assign a dedicated streaming technician

Post-Production: Where the Magic Happens
The last stage is editing and polishing your footage to create compelling, shareable content.
1. Craft a Strong Story
Your event highlight video should:
Build energy
Feature key moments
Showcase your brand’s message
Editors use pacing, transitions, and music to create emotional impact.
2. Add Professional Graphics
Polished graphics improve clarity and brand cohesion:
Lower thirds
Name titles
Logo animations
Chapter markers
Intro/outro sequences
This ensures your content looks professional across all platforms.
3. Optimize for Each Platform
Different channels require different formats:
Vertical for TikTok and Instagram Reels
Square for Facebook
16:9 for YouTube and websites
Delivering multiple versions maximizes the reach of your event footage.
4. Consider Repurposing
One event can generate weeks or months of content:
Speaker clips
Social media snippets
Recap videos
Testimonial videos
Training modules

2. Can you livestream events from government buildings or secure venues in Washington, DC?
Yes, most professional video production companies, including TriVision, can livestream from secure venues. However, some federal buildings require approved access, security clearances, or A/V coordination with in-house staff. Planning ahead is key.

4. How much does event video production cost in the DMV area?
Pricing varies depending on:
Number of cameras
Length of the event
AV and Livestreaming needs
Number of crew members
Video editing requirements
